ComutaNet taxis to encourage take up of Telkom IPO
The Government is planning to offer for sale to the public, particularly Historically Disadvantaged Individuals, some of its shares in Telkom S.A, South Africa's national telecommunications company. This initial public offering (IPO) of shares in Telkom will be open to all South Africans, particularly those who may not have had the chance to invest in shares before.
To communicate this opportunity to the nation, Telkom and its agencies, Optimedia and Saatchi and Saatchi, commissioned 750 ComutaNet taxis to deliver the message across the country.
Intent on encouraging everyone to participate in the offer, the creative execution will be changed three times during the campaign period with more information being added each time. The first execution illustrates a pool of water that is made up of many drops which is supported with the pay off line "Our strength is in our sharing". Using both side and back panels for advertising, commuters are invited to call a Telkom Share phone number or visit the website for more information on the public offering.
During the initial four-month taxi campaign, Telkom’s share offer message will impact on at least 9,5 million taxi passengers as possible shareholders, and this excludes the additional impacts on the vast number of other commuters and pedestrians.
